Experiment 1: Fusion Food with a Hispanic Twist One of the most intriguing ways to experiment with Hispanic recipes is by fusing them with other cuisines. By combining different flavors and ingredients, you can create unique and unforgettable dishes. For example, you could try blending traditional Mexican tacos with Japanese sushi techniques, resulting in mouthwatering sushi tacos or explore the fusion of Spanish paella with Thai curry for a bold and flavorful dish. The possibilities are endless, and experimenting with fusion cuisine will surely impress your guests and tantalize their taste buds. Experiment 2: Playful Presentation Another creative way to elevate Hispanic recipes is by focusing on the presentation. Instead of serving typical dishes in the same traditional manner, explore alternative ways to visually impress your guests. For instance, you can transform empanadas into bite-sized appetizers by creating empanada sliders with different fillings and colorful toppings. Or, think outside the box by serving ceviche in individual martini glasses, garnished with tortilla chips for a unique and elegant twist. Experimenting with presentation adds a fun element to your culinary creations and enhances the overall dining experience. Experiment 3: Modernizing Traditional Recipes While staying true to traditional Hispanic recipes is important, there is always room for contemporary twists. For example, you can modernize classic dishes like arroz con pollo (rice with chicken) by using alternative grains such as quinoa or bulgur, or by incorporating unique spices and herbs to create a flavor profile that matches your personal taste. Additionally, you can experiment with using new cooking techniques, such as sous vide or grilling, to add a modern touch to traditional favorites like carne asada or pescado a la plancha. Experiment 4: Infusing Hispanic Ingredients Hispanic cuisine is known for its diversity of ingredients, including staples like chiles, cilantro, avocados, and tropical fruits. Experimenting with these ingredients can elevate your culinary creations to new heights. For instance, you can infuse unique flavors into classic dishes by incorporating smoky chipotle peppers into a traditional tomato sauce for a spicy twist. Or, try adding fresh mango or pineapple to salsas and guacamole for a refreshing burst of sweetness. Playing around with Hispanic ingredients will undoubtedly bring exciting and unexpected flavors to your table. Experiment 5: Creating Homemade Condiments and Sauces To truly take DIY experimentation to the next level, why not try making your own condiments and sauces from scratch? From salsa verde to mole, experimenting with homemade condiments allows you to customize the flavor profile to your liking. You can adjust the spice level, experiment with different herbs and seasonings, or even create a completely new sauce by combining various traditional recipes. This not only ensures a fresh and unique taste but also showcases your creativity in the kitchen.
